Wyclef for President!

Written by Tom Gilhuley on August 4, 2010 in Thought Leaders


According to the BBC and various other sources, Wyclef Jean is going to announce he’s running for president of Haiti. All I can say is, AWESOME! It’s about time a musician gets on the ballot instead of all these actors out there. Many of my favorite artists write and sing about politics, but this is the first instances where I actually get to see a musician run for office with a serious chance of winning. Very exciting.

Wyclef was born in Haiti, and has been supporting the people of Haiti through his charity work and regular visits to the country. After the devastation following the big earthquake, he felt now was the time to help the people of Haiti advance their country, especially in terms of technology and infrastructure. I hope he wins and gets the job done. It’ll be fun to watch how he runs his campaign and uses the online space to raise awareness and dollars. Go get ‘em.
